He felt disoriented on seeing the picture. After rubbing his eyes, he looked again. Yes, there she was…prominent in her white bag and blue jacket, studying something.
How could this be true? His mind was probably playing tricks on him. When he had clicked that picture, there was no one around.
He was aging and she looked just the way she had looked on their last day in college.
Twenty years back, they had parted, ready to pursue their separate careers, fully aware that they would never ever meet again.
But she had surprised him by extracting a promise. They were to meet exactly twenty years later at this favourite haunt to celebrate their friendship.
He had remembered the promise and had gone to that spot. But how could he expect her to be there? He knew she had long been dead… soon after she left college!
(This is a tribute to ‘After Twenty Years’-a lovely short story by the great O Henry)
